Kaynağa Gözat

Merge remote-tracking branch 'origin/dev' into dev

jinwenhai 6 gün önce
ebeveyn
işleme
943505df14

+ 6 - 0
nightFragrance-massage/src/main/java/com/ylx/massage/domain/vo/MerchantVo.java

@@ -50,4 +50,10 @@ public class MerchantVo implements Serializable {
     @ApiModelProperty("最低价格")
     private BigDecimal price;
 
+    /**
+     * 商户形象照
+     */
+    @ApiModelProperty("形象照,展示")
+    private String avatar;
+
 }

+ 2 - 2
nightFragrance-massage/src/main/resources/mapper/massage/MaProjectMapper.xml

@@ -128,7 +128,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
             AVG(mp.project_current_price) AS avgCurrentPrice,
             pro.highlight               AS highlight
         FROM project pro
-        INNER JOIN ma_project mp ON CAST(mp.project_id AS UNSIGNED) = pro.id AND mp.merchant_type = '0' AND mp.is_delete = 0 AND mp.project_is_enable = 1
+        INNER JOIN ma_project mp ON CAST(mp.project_id AS UNSIGNED) = pro.id AND mp.merchant_type = 1 AND mp.is_delete = 0 AND mp.project_is_enable = 1
         LEFT JOIN t_order o ON o.project_id = pro.id AND o.project_type = 1 AND o.status = 6 AND o.is_delete = 0
         WHERE pro.is_delete = 0
         AND EXISTS (
@@ -185,7 +185,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
         ) stat ON stat.merchant_id = t.id
         WHERE p.audit_status = 1
           AND p.is_delete = 0
-          AND p.merchant_type = 0
+          AND p.merchant_type = 1
           AND p.project_is_enable = 0
           AND t.audit_status = 2
           AND t.is_delete = 0

+ 2 - 1
nightFragrance-massage/src/main/resources/mapper/massage/MaTechnicianMapper.xml

@@ -385,6 +385,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
             t.n_star AS nStar,
             COALESCE(o.sales, 0) AS nNum,
             COALESCE(p.min_price, 0) AS price,
+            t.avatar AS avatar,
             -- 返回米(四舍五入保留0位小数,也可不ROUND)
             ROUND(ST_Distance_Sphere(POINT(a.longitude, a.latitude), POINT(#{dto.longitude}, #{dto.latitude})), 0) AS distance
         FROM ma_technician t
@@ -397,7 +398,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
         LEFT JOIN (
             SELECT merchant_id, MIN(project_current_price) AS min_price
             FROM ma_project
-            WHERE is_delete = 0 AND audit_status = 1 AND merchant_type = '0' AND project_is_enable = 1
+            WHERE is_delete = 0 AND audit_status = 1 AND merchant_type = 1 AND project_is_enable = 1
             GROUP BY merchant_id
         ) p ON t.id = p.merchant_id
         LEFT JOIN (